Compensation for Economic Losses

Settlements are the most commonly used method of settling medical bills and other economic losses that you suffer after a car crash. The amount you receive is contingent upon a variety of factors including the severity of your injury and the time it could be to treat.

Other losses could include funds you've lost when your injuries have prevented you from working or from engaging in hobbies and other activities that were important to you prior to your accident. Insurance companies may ask for documents detailing these expenses and an official note from your doctor detailing how your injuries have affected your.

Non-economic damages, such as pain and suffering, are more difficult to quantify than quantifiable expenses like medical expenses and lost wages. Insurance companies employ an increase multiplier dependent on medical expenses to cover these intangible losses. The more the multiplier is higher, the more severe your injury.

New York law does not limit the amount of damages you are entitled to for suffering and pain, but certain states place limits on this kind of compensation. A reputable lawyer can assist you in understanding the benefits your insurance company is offering you and help you get the compensation you deserve.

Compensation for Non-Economic Losses

While economic damages are relatively easy to calculate, non-economic losses can be a bit more difficult. These can include emotional pain, suffering, loss of enjoyment as a result of not being able do your favorite hobbies or activities. It could also mean loss of consortium, when you're married and disfigurement. An experienced attorney can assist you in determining the exact extent of non-economic damages, and ensure you receive adequate compensation.

You must have complete and complete medical documents to maximize the amount you receive. This includes police reports, medical reports from all doctors who have treated you after the accident, photos of your injuries as well as damage to your vehicle, and any other evidence that may help you prove your claim. Keep copies of these documents in both formats to help speed up settlement.
